Abstract

Pharmaceutical researchers remains uncertain about enhancing the water solubility and dissolution of medications, the objective of this study was to ascertain whether the liquisolid compact formulation of the BCS class II medications Quetiapine Fumarate could enhance its solubility and consequently its dissolution rate to make the Liquisolid compact a number of non volatile solvents were used. Liquisolid preparation made with non volatile solvent labrafac and peccol have shown promising results. Quetiapine Fumarate liquisolid tablets made from peccol or labara dissolve better than other LS formulations, it was found that the best formulations of Quetiapine Fumarate had a hardness of 2.8kg/cm2 a drug release of 99.58%after 10mins, and an angle of repose of 23.24oC obtained, the results for the designed product made with LS compacts technology showed quick release when compared to the pure medication.
